#d76688 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d76688 is composed of 84.3% red, 40%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52.6% magenta, 36.7%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 341.9 degrees, a saturation of 58.5% and a lightness of 62.2%. #d76688 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ffccff with #af0011.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

● #d76688 color description : Moderate pink.
#d76688 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d76688 has RGB values of R:215, G:102,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.53, Y:0.37,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14116488.

Shades and Tints of #d76688
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fcf2f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d76688
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a39a9d is the less saturated color, while #fc4179 is the most saturated one.
